logo

Output 86003bd29605281b8fb41f196015076187b17cada2035c9de27caac0ae1f902e:1

value
24064
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7e1828194d57a4fbdb3938443abb381e7ace4a9 OP_EQUALVERIFY OP_CHECKSIG
address
1KDscsQmw7AFEhEmBXE62RbjoUHeGtAkSK
transaction
86003bd29605281b8fb41f196015076187b17cada2035c9de27caac0ae1f902e